Output 50fc486a64c2c97b2fe2e2161ffd035ecb70975bc1a8e77858634d673383b76b:0

value
643644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d0d139b7b72c7bb9e03f35f9b64467872a787b1 OP_EQUAL
address
3Qm2YeuSYPgZwU8wm64kcL5SsReBKGWNdg
transaction
50fc486a64c2c97b2fe2e2161ffd035ecb70975bc1a8e77858634d673383b76b
confirmations
172291
spent
true